Output 184e23866157131e2315dd5c6266ac085c1851106558bd2ced2fdcfddb3e4ac0:8

value
40594312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61d4f05c12cea12d5a3e1f9a91f7041723bbf0b1 OP_EQUAL
address
MGpSsHuKXExhEbeGcKRRvjn1TbAREXBK6u
transaction
184e23866157131e2315dd5c6266ac085c1851106558bd2ced2fdcfddb3e4ac0
spent
true